The Opportunity

Exactera is reimagining how the world's finance and tax leaders get their most technical, highest-stakes work done, replacing legacy advisory relationships with an AI-first, tech-enabled services model. Our International Tax business, anchored by Transfer Pricing Compliance & Advisory, is our most established business, built on a proven, repeatable sales playbook. Within it, Advisory is our newest and fastest-growing service line: the right AE gets real room to help shape how it's sold, backed by the stability of a Compliance motion Exactera has already proven out.

We are hiring a US-based Account Executive to drive new logo growth for Transfer Pricing. This is a full-cycle sales role: you will receive qualified pipeline from a dedicated SDR team, run a consultative sales process with Tax Directors, VPs of Tax, Controllers, and CFOs, and close new business that grows Exactera's footprint in the US market. You will have strong sales enablement and coaching behind you, and a playbook that already works, but we still need someone who brings their own engine: a self-starter who builds pipeline on their own initiative rather than only working what's handed to them, and who is genuinely AI-first in how they prospect, prepare, manage their pipeline, and evolve their GTM process.


What You Will Own
  • Run a full-cycle, new logo sales motion for Transfer Pricing Compliance, from SDR-sourced and self-sourced pipeline through close
  • Sell into the Finance function, building credibility with Tax Directors, VPs of Tax/Finance, Controllers, and CFOs by translating transfer pricing complexity into a clear, defensible business case
  • Help shape how we sell Transfer Pricing Advisory, building on the proven Compliance playbook rather than starting from a blank page
  • Partner closely with your SDR to sharpen targeting, messaging, and account prioritization within your book
  • Keep a disciplined, accurate pipeline in our CRM, with realistic stages and timelines that make forecasting trustworthy
  • Use Exactera's AI-first tools to work faster and smarter across prospecting, deal prep, and account research, and bring your own AI workflow to the table
  • Engage actively with sales enablement content and coaching, and apply the feedback to continuously improve your craft
  • Represent Exactera's Transfer Pricing value proposition credibly against Big 4 and legacy advisory alternatives

Who You Are
  • 5 to 10 years of quota-carrying, full-cycle B2B sales experience, with a strong preference for experience selling into the Finance function (tax, accounting, treasury, or related technical buyers)
  • A demonstrated track record of generating a real share of your own pipeline through deliberate outbound effort, not solely reliant on inbound or SDR handoff
  • Genuinely AI-first in your day-to-day workflow: you already use AI tools to prospect, prepare, and manage your pipeline, and you look for ways to work smarter, not just harder
  • Strong consultative selling skills, ideally grounded in a structured, value-based sales methodology (e.g., MEDDPICC or similar), and comfortable navigating multi-stakeholder, technical sales cycles with longer time horizons
  • Comfortable operating inside an established, proven sales motion while also helping shape a newer one still being built
  • Coachable and competitive: you want the enablement and coaching we provide, and you use it to get better rather than resist structure
  • Comfortable selling complex or technical services and translating them into business outcomes for a non-technical buyer

What Success Looks Like
  • Fully ramped and carrying a complete quota within the first 90 to 120 days
  • A consistently accurate, well-managed pipeline that reflects real deal stage and timing, fed by both SDR handoff and your own outbound effort
  • New logo Transfer Pricing bookings at or above target attainment
  • Contributing real feedback and playbook improvements as Transfer Pricing Advisory's sales motion takes shape
  • A rep who's known internally for using AI to move faster on the fundamentals, not to skip them

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
